Regular expressions are used to generate patterns of strings. A regular expression describes patterns using operators like union, concatenation, and Kleene closure. Some examples of regular expressions include:
1) Describing Canadian postal codes as /^[A-Z][0-9][A-Z] [0-9][A-Z][0-9]$/
2) Matching strings containing the word "main" as <letter>* main <letter>*
3) Matching strings of even length as (<letter><letter>)*

America is facing an affordable housing crisis. Where do transit agencies fit in? A large portion of transit ridership is made up of lower-income, transit-dependent patrons. Hear how crisis has spurred innovation and how transit agencies and their partners are tackling the problem, head on: The FTA has added affordable housing to the New Starts criteria. Los Angeles Metro has set a goal that 35 percent of housing on Metro land be affordable. In the Bay Area, the Metropolitan Transportation Commission is investing in affordable TOD. Syntax directed translation associates semantic rules and actions with a context-free grammar to evaluate expressions during parsing. It allows parsers to perform semantic checks and code generation by storing values in symbol tables and generating intermediate code as parsing occurs through techniques like top-down left-to-right parsing. An example is given of using these methods to evaluate the expression 2 + 3 * 4 during parsing.

La Convención establece los derechos de todos los niños y niñas menores de 18 años a la supervivencia, protección, desarrollo y participación. Los Estados deben tomar medidas para garantizar estos derechos independientemente de raza, religión u otras características, respetando al mismo tiempo los derechos y deberes de los padres. La Convención cubre una amplia gama de derechos como la salud, educación, descanso y protección contra la explotación o abuso.
